    After walking along the river, we popped in to the mini-golf attraction. No pre-booking required. Kr 60 per adult, kr 35 for under-16s and you can take as long as you like/need on the 18 holes. Really friendly staff. No skill needed per se, which makes it a lot of fun. If it’s sunny, bring a hat - little shade but plenty of benches and a loo, which is good. We spent an hour or more and all really enjoyed it. Perfect location next to restaurants for afterwards. Recommended!
